I had exchanged a LSD diff into my oz spec AE86, but my mechanic found that the input shaft of the new diff is longer than the original one, this make the drive shaft had to be put 6mm toward the gear box (but the car still run ok). Should such situation will cause any damage? should I exhange a drive shaft from another model?

hes not quite using the same set up as me Sam, what you need to do is take the back half of the T18 tailshaft and mate it to the front half of the AE86 shaft and it should be the perfect length.... the T series diff housing is just that little bit longer Smile

Oh dont dorget to ballance the shaft after you put it all together Smile
